YouTube and Reddit are accused of contributing to the 'radicalization' of the Tops supermarket shooter in Buffalo, New York, in a pair of new lawsuits.

They allege that YouTube – as well as its parent companies Alphabet Inc. and Google – and Reddit contributed to the"radicalization" of Payton Gendron, who was 18 years old when he opened fire at the Tops Friendly Market in Buffalo on May 14, 2022. Ten people were killed, all of them Black, and three others were wounded.
The first suit was filed on behalf of Wayne Jones, the son of 65-year-old Celestine Chaney, one of the 10 people killed. The second suit seeks compensation for 16 survivors who argue that, while they were not shot, they suffered"lasting harm and severe emotional distress" as a result of being at the scene.

They further charge that Reddit Inc."operates a defectively designed social media product that the shooter used, became radicalized on, and gave him information he needed to equip himself for the mass shooting, including about RMA Armament’s combat-style body armor."
